Does God want you healed that is a question that needs to be answered and settled in your thinking because your way of thinking can hinder you from receiving your healing (3John 2). And the best place to find this out is from the Bible, not from peoples opinions or what they been taught, but from the Bible. First, every child of God has a covenant of healing. Notice in Luke 13 there was a woman with a spirit of infirmity and Jesus said, "Ought not this woman, being a daughter of Abraham, whom Satan has bound, lo, these eighteen years, be loosed from this bond on the sabbath day?" Notice, Jesus said she ought to be loosed because she was a daughter of Abraham. What was he saying, she has a covenant of healing and God is faithful to his covenant. He promised to never break it or alter it (Psalm 89:34). So what does that have to do with you, in Galatians 3:29 it says, "If ye be Christ's then are you Abraham's seed." And God is no respecter of persons, so just as Jesus said that woman ought to be loosed because she was a seed of Abraham, that's how He sees you. An important note I want to call your attention to is notice Jesus said, "Whom Satan has bound", because there are some who believes that God puts sickness on you. But, notice in Acts 10:38 it says that Jesus healed all that were oppressed of the devil. God anointed Jesus to heal the sick, so how could He be putting sickness on you. Jesus said, "Every kingdom divided against itself is brought to desolation: and every city or house divided against itself shall not stand." So, if God's the one putting sickness on you and healing you then He's working against himself.
Second, Jesus paid for your healing with his own blood. The same blood that purchased your forgiveness of sins also purchased your healing (1Peter 2:24). So, just as God doesn't want anyone to perish, He also doesn't want anyone sick. He wants his will done in the earth just as it is done in heaven (Matthew 6:10). When someone pays for something for you then it's obvious that they want you to have it. For example you take someone out to a buffet to eat and you pay for them, you want them to have free access to all that is on the buffet. In fact you feel best when they take advantage of what you paid for. If you paid for them to eat and all they came back with is a peice of bread you wouldn't feel right. Because for one thing you would feel like your money was wasted because they didn't take advantage of what you paid for. Third, He tells you how to get healed. In James 5:14,15 God tells you how to get healed by the prayer of faith. If healing isn't his will how can you pray the prayer of faith. And He tells you in the next verse to pray one for another that you may be healed. That's one way God has for you to receive healing and there's other ways. Why would He have so many ways of receiving healing if it wasn't his will. And fourth, He's your father and what kind of father would not want to see his child healed (Romans 8:15). Especially one that has the power to do something about it. Well, that's just a few things the Bible has to say on the subject you decide what you are going to believe.
